History & Origin

AWP | LongDog released March 31, 2025 as part of the Train 2025 Collection.

It's a Counter-Strike 2-native release, launched after Valve's September 2023 relaunch, with no CS:GO history of its own.

It launched as a Covert-tier finish, with a Souvenir edition but no StatTrak™ version.

Wear & Float

AWP | LongDog ships in all five wear conditions, from Factory New through Battle-Scarred, across the full 0.00–1.00 float range.

As with every CS2 skin, lower float values look cleaner: Factory New copies (roughly below 0.07 float) show the finish at its sharpest, while Field-Tested and Well-Worn pieces make up the most commonly traded middle ground between mint and heavily worn.

Availability & Drop Mechanics

AWP | LongDog is part of the Train 2025 Collection rather than being unboxed from a traditional weapon Case — the Collection is not tied to any live drop mechanic, so trade-ups and the Steam Community Market are the main ways to acquire one.

Valve has never published exact Collection odds. The estimate above (1 in 781, 0.1280%) applies the same rarity-tier cascade confirmed for Cases, giving a general sense of scale rather than a guaranteed rate.

Versions & Variants

Alongside the Normal version, this finish also has a Souvenir edition — there's no StatTrak™ counterpart.

Beyond that, there's no separate "phase" or pattern family tied to this finish in the site's data — it's tracked as a single fixed look across every wear condition it ships in.

Trivia & Related Information

It's the only Covert-tier item in the Train 2025 Collection — the rarest possible pull that source can produce.
